Returning to golf, pickleball, tennis, or softball this season?

Many people are surprised when shoulder or elbow pain starts showing up after a few weeks of playing.

The reason is often not a single injury.

It's usually:

🏌️ Swing after swing
🎾 Serve after serve
⚾ Throw after throw

Over time, tissues can fatigue faster than they adapt.

The good news?

Pain doesn't always mean something is damaged. Often, it means activity levels increased faster than the body was prepared to handle.

Most people expect pain to go away quickly.

A few days.
Maybe a couple of weeks.

When it doesn’t, frustration sets in.

It’s common to start wondering:
“Why am I still feeling this?”
“Is something wrong?”
“Is this even working?”

But pain lasting longer than expected doesn’t automatically mean damage is still happening.

Often, it means your body is still adapting.

Healing isn’t just about reducing pain in the moment.
It’s about rebuilding tolerance to movement and daily activity.

Real progress often looks like:
• Fewer flare-ups
• Better movement quality
• Faster recovery after activity

That’s still progress — even if symptoms fluctuate.
